I Luv NY (read as "I Love New York"), is a television program of GMA Network. Set in New York City, it is the first Philippine TV soap to hold tapings in New York, around which revolves the story of the four main characters.
The show is shot around different locations in the city, where the characters lived their lives and encountered many problems and adventures. The series received a viewership rating of 33.4% for its whole run.
In this teleserye, only 4 of the actors (Jolina,Marvin,Jennylyn and Mark)were sent to New York for filming. While in the teleserye Crazy for You, almost half of the cast were sent to Barcelona.

- Magdangal and Agustin previously appeared as a love team in several of ABS-CBN's television programs.
- Mercado, Herras previously appeared as a love team in GMA Network television programs and both of them, plus Tan, Reyes, Jareno and de Jesus were alumni of StarStruck talent search.
- The soap features cameo appearances by Joey de Leon, Allan K. and Sugar of "Eat Bulaga". Likewise, Joey's daughter Jocas de Leon (who graduated Magna Cum Laude at New York's Fordham University) has a small part in the series as Jolina's hotel supervisor.
- In the later part of the show, Pinoy Pop Superstar grand champions, Gerald Santos (from Season 2) and Jonalyn Viray (from Season 1) were included.
